Buko Pandan Dessert Perfect Treat During Ramadan

KOTA BHARU, April 12 (Bernama) — Buko pandan, a sweet and creamy Filipino dessert, made of jelly cubes, young coconut, and sweetened cream infused with a variety of flavours, makes a perfect treat during Ramadan.

In fact, Idda Melisa Sukiman, who sells the mouth-watering cold dessert said, there had been a three-fold rise in demand since the start of the fasting month.

Idda Melisa, 38, learned how to make the buko pandan when she attended a cookery class organised by a professional chef from the Philippines sometime in 2018.

“I make the buko pandan dessert all year round but I will be kept busy during Ramadan to cope with  the increased number of orders .

The ingredients needed to make buko pandan are corn, coconut flesh, fruit cocktail, nata de coco, gelatine, whipped cream, evaporated and condensed milk.

“I will usually make the jelly a day before preparing the sweet creamy sauce with pandan, lychee, mango and longan flavours,“ she told Bernama when met at her house in Kampung Putih here today.

Elaborating, Idda Melisa said daily she prepares about 1,500 containers of buko pandan for sale during this Ramadan.

The dessert containers come in three sizes where the M-sized containers are sold at RM12 each, L (RM37) and XL (RM70).

“Apart from local customers I also receive orders from people in Perak, Johor, Penang, Kuala Lumpur and Selangor,” said Idda Melisa who is thankful for the growing popularity of her product and currently runs the business assisted by seven workers.

“I started the business with a capital of RM150 and as the sales increased I could afford to buy a coconut shredder machine and a packaging machine to facilitate production,” she said.

“Customers have already started to place orders to serve the dessert to guests during Hari Raya Aidilfitri,” she added.
